A proposal has been made to create an additional BOLT (tentatively BOLT 12) to allow operators of domain names to create SRV records for their nodes, thereby allowing users to independently look up and connect to that domain's advertised nodes and open channels. This would improve security by reducing the risk of nodes masquerading as other nodes and provide subdomains to distinguish between nodes intended for a specific purpose. Christian expressed concerns about the selective attachment to a merchant's node, stating that it is not beneficial for either the node opening the channel or the network as a whole. He believes that channels should be opened ahead of time to avoid on-chain confirmations during the first payment, and that future payments going through a single merchant could result in the creation of user profiles by that merchant. Additionally, this could create a network of large hubs that are only weakly interconnected unless the merchants maintain connections among each other. However, Christian does like the possibility of looking up a merchant's node ID through DNS to optimize connectivity. Tyler and Robert have created a draft RFC for the proposed BOLT, and feedback is appreciated.
